Whenever your car or truck's transmission commences performing up, it won't just make driving inconvenient — it may possibly set your full regime in jeopardy. Whether or not you're commuting to operate, having the youngsters to highschool, or setting up a weekend excursion on the Seaside, your car’s transmission is central to your veh… Read More